I'm not saying no because it is technically hard. I'm saying no because mail-archive is for fully public lists, and that clearly is not compatible with your request. Additionally, at least in the current incarnation, I have no interest in providing custom work or enhancements to individual lists -- I don't do mail-archive because I'm a good samaritan or something, it's because I'm personally interested and enjoy building and running a large scale fully automated useful system. Any per-list work from me is a step backwards that I'm not motivated to take. That may change some day in the future, but not today. > Ok, is there way to totally remove a mailing list from your server? Have your lists stop sending archive@jab.org mail, then privately email me the listnames and I will nuke the archives. And please do not use mail-archive for any list ever again (i.e. consider yourself banned from the service for life.) As explanation, there is no personal malice or anything -- but I don't want private lists anywhere on mail-archive and I have the ban policy for lists that change their mind or are confused or something to help cut down on my per-list workload (something that I want to see as close to zero as possible).
